Abstract

This contribution gives an overview about new procedures for the parameter identification for the material characterisation of rubber blends. They are based on a Newton-Raphson procedure and a genetic algorithm. As basis serves an experimental investigation of the viscous properties of rubber blends by means of a capillaryviscometer. Because of simultaneous consideration of wall slippage, temperature and of the die swell, the proposed material characterisation is represented by a coupled system of nonlinear equations. Describing their solutions requires a numerical integration algorithm. For this purpose a generalized Newton-Raphson scheme has been adopted. The verification of the developed parameter identification was done by means of another approach which is based on a genetic algorithm.
